When buying copy paper, numerous elements ought to be considered to ensure you choose the ideal type for your particular requirements:

Weight: The weight of the paper impacts its density and feel. Lightweight papers (20 pounds) are appropriate for everyday printing, while much heavier weight papers (24 lbs and above) offer a more premium feel and are ideal for top quality documents.

Brightness: The brightness level of paper can significantly impact the readability and look of printed materials. The greater the brightness percentage, the whiter and more lively the prints appear.

Finish: The finish of the paper can range from smooth to textured. A smooth surface is perfect for sharp text and images, while a textured finish can include a more visual appeal, particularly for invitations or discussions.

Environmental Considerations: If sustainability is a priority for your organization, think about recycled paper alternatives. These papers are usually made from post-consumer waste and can help in reducing your carbon footprint.

Amount Needed: Consider the volume of printing required. Buying wholesale can frequently result in cost savings, however it's crucial to balance bulk buying with storage capabilities.
